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of glacier

- An immense field or stream of ice, formed in the region of perpetual snow, and moving slowly down a mountain slope or valley, as in the Alps, or over an extended area, as in Greenland.

Crossword clue for glacier

- Creeping ice mass
- Ice mass
- One hundred and one fell into large turbulent icy river
- River of ice
- Slow-moving mass of ice
- Slowly moving mass of ice